4 Reasons Drivers Love the 2025 Ford Mustang Mach-E

Winning over loyal pony car fans with a new body style and powertrain is a near-impossible feat. But the 2025 Ford Mustang Mach-E pulls it off fantastically, making every driver fall in love with its high-performance electric powertrain, traditional Mustang looks, and exciting technology. It Offers Zippy Acceleration The Mustang Mach-E offers an assortment of powertrain configurations, including several that are tuned for the track. The base model features a single rear-axle-mounted motor, producing 264 hp and 387 lb.-ft of torque. Drivers who want additional power and traction can opt for the available dual-motor eAWD system, which amps up the output to 325 hp and 500 lb.-ft of torque. For true track-ready performance, the Mustang Mach-E lineup includes the GT and Rally trim levels, both of which feature performance eAWD systems paired with an extended-range battery. The top-of-the-line Rally trim produces a monstrous 480 hp and 700 lb-ft of torque. On the racetrack, this translates to a 0-to-60-mph time of 3.3 seconds and a quarter-mile time of 11.8 seconds. more It Features Selectable Drive Modes The Mustang Mach-E's performance can be customized using six selectable drive modes. Engage mode balances performance with efficiency, Whisper mode enhances traction and makes operation silent, and 1-Pedal Drive mode maximizes efficiency. For sporty driving dynamics, the SUV offers Unbridle and Unbridle Extended modes to amp up the throttle response and add extra steering weight. An exclusive RallySport mode, which is only offered in the Rally trim level, adjusts the SUV's yaw, throttle response, and damping for off-roading. It Has an Eye-Catching Design Despite its SUV body style, the Mustang Mach-E is unmistakably a Mustang, featuring a traditional trapezoidal grille, signature tri-bar LED headlights and taillights, and an illuminated pony badge. Stylish 19-inch machine-face aluminum wheels with black-painted pockets are standard, but buyers can opt for the larger 20-inch wheels that come in a variety of finishes. The Mach-E offers eight distinct monotone exterior paints, including premium options like Star White Metallic Tri-coat and Molten Magenta Metallic Tinted Clearcoat. It Has a Tech-Forward Interior A host of in-cabin technologies enhances the travel experience. The SUV offers a 15.5-inch infotainment screen with SYNC 4A technology, which includes video streaming services, wireless smartphone connectivity, natural voice recognition, and integrated navigation. An available 10-speaker B&O sound system brings studio-quality beats to the cabin and includes a subwoofer to amplify bass. Other standard in-cabin tech features are wireless phone charging, Wi-Fi hotspot capability, and ambient interior lighting. Adventure Beckons in the 2025 Ford Explorer

When adventure calls, how will you answer? The 2025 Ford Explorer delivers the power, utility, and comfort to make every journey more fun, whether it's across town or across the continent. Brings Along Everyone and Everything The 2025 Explorer has plenty of room for the whole family and their gear. With three rows of seating available, the Explorer can accommodate up to 7 passengers, so nobody has to stay behind. The available PowerFold third-row seat makes configuring the Explorer for more passengers or added cargo easy and quick, and the standard power liftgate makes accessing the cargo compartment very convenient. The Explorer is also a cargo-carrying champion. With a jaw-dropping 46 cubic feet of cargo volume behind the second row, there's room for bags and belongings galore inside. And with a towing capacity of up to 5,000 pounds and Ford's Class III Tow Package included with every trim, the family boat or camper can come along with ease. more Comfort in Every Seat The Explorer's cavernous interior ensures there's plenty of room for every rider to stretch out, which makes even long journeys comfortable. And with standard heated seats in the first row and available heating for second-row seats, even chilly mornings give Explorer families nothing to fear. Available leather trim adds a feeling of lushness and luxury to every ride. Standard privacy glass aft of the B pillar helps keep prying eyes at bay. The driver's seat may be the most comfortable position of all. The available heated steering wheel and standard 10-way power adjustable seat makes it easy to find your perfect seating position. Endless Entertainment With standard w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ay compatibility and stunning Bang & Olufsen sound systems standard on almost every trim, the Explorer is the perfect vehicle for families who like to jam out together. Every 2025 Explorer is equipped with a 5G LTE Wi-Fi Hotspot modem for the ultimate in connectivity, which is activated with the FordPass Connect system. Let The Explorer Take the Wheel Just because you're in the driver's seat, who says you should have to do all the driving? Most trims of the 2025 Explorer are equipped to enable Ford's BlueCruise advanced driver assist software, which lets the driver go hands-free on over 130,000 miles of highway across North America. The result? Lower workload, less tiredness at the end of the drive, and more ability to focus on being with the people you cherish. Safety Comes Standard Explorer families sleep soundly at night knowing their SUV is looking out for them. The standard SOS Post-Crash Alert System activates emergency services if the Explorer is involved in a collision, and a full suite of airbags includes knee airbags in front and side curtain airbags to protect outboard riders in the unlikely event of a rollover. Conquer Any Terrain: The 2025 Ford Bronco

Adventurous and ready to tackle the most demanding terrains while boasting a modern design with plenty of first-class tech and interior features, the 2025 Ford Bronco is ready for test drives, with both two and four-door models to choose from. Powerful Performance Turbocharged performance meets smooth shifting in this edition of the Ford Bronco, as it offers three stunning engines that pair with either a seven-speed manual or 10-speed automatic transmission, depending on the trim level and engine you choose. The first engine, a 2.3-liter I-4, delivers 300 horsepower, enough to make an easy task out of most challenges. The intermediate engine is a 330-horsepower 2.7-liter V6, though the most power is offered by the third option, a 418-horsepower 3.0-liter V6. Ready for Off-Roading Designed for conquering nature, this SUV has impressive versatility-enhancing features built in already, including a part-time selectable 4x4 system that can be toggled on and off at will. Also included is a terrain management system called G.O.A.T. (Goes Over Any Type of Terrain) Modes and the H.O.S.S. Suspension System, which has been well-tested for high-speed off-road performance. Select trims also have high clearance ride height, semi-active dampers for smoother rides, and an advanced 4x4 system with Automatic On-Demand Engagement. more A Comfortable Interior The vehicle's acoustic windshield provides peaceful drives inside the cabin, and while the base model has standard climate control, select upper trims have a dual-zone system and heated front seats. There's also a rear split-folding bench seat in every model for larger cargo, while smaller items can always be placed in the Molle panel system, also standard, or in the optional console lock box. As for seating materials, they range from leather trim to marine-grade vinyl among the different models. A Nature-Ready Design The vehicle's exterior provides plenty of convenience in its design, as it comes with a 150-degree manual swing gate, as well as a removable top and doors for exploring nature in open-air style. Select trims also come with bash plates, fog lamps, tow hooks, and rock rails for taking on extreme conditions. Many nature-based paint colors are available to choose from as well, with highlights like Marsh Gray, Velocity Blue, and Eruption Green. Next-Level Technology This edition also has advanced tech, like the SYNC 4 infotainment system, which pairs with the Rear View Camera, also standard, and the available 360-degree camera system. There are plenty of tech options for off-roading too, including an off-road cruise control called Trail Control, Trail 1-Pedal Drive for using one pedal to accelerate and brake, and Trail Turn Assist for enhanced turning diameter. Pre-Collision Assist, Trailer Sway Control, and plenty of other driver-assist features come standard as well. The 2025 Ford Bronco vs. the 2025 Ford Bronco Sport: Off-Road Icon vs. City-Friendly SUV

If you're looking for an adventure SUV, the 2025 Ford Bronco and the 2025 Ford Bronco Sport stand out from the crowd. They are both built for the trails, but the big Bronco is more suitable for extreme off-roading, whereas the smaller Bronco Sport is more city-friendly. Here's a comparison between the two to know what to expect during a test drive at your Ford dealership. Comparing the 2025 Ford Bronco vs. the 2025 Ford Bronco Sport at Your Ford Dealership Engine Options Designed with tough terrains in mind, the 2025 Bronco offers a selection of highly capable powertrains. Its base engine, a 2.3L EcoBoost I-4, delivers 300 horsepower and 325 pound-feet of torque and pairs with a seven-speed manual transmission, giving you the confidence to tackle most off-roading situations. Four-wheel drive is standard, and with a towing capacity of 3,500 pounds, the Bronco is well-equipped for whatever the day brings. Perfect for daily driving and casual adventures, the Bronco Sport comes standard with a 180-hp 1.5L EcoBoost engine, an eight-speed automatic transmission, and four-wheel drive, delivering EPA estimates of 25 MPG in the city and 30 MPG on the highway, as well as a towing capacity of 2,200 pounds. Both models offer more powerful powertrains, offering up to 418 horsepower in the Bronco and 250 horsepower in the Bronco Sport. more Terrain Capabilities Each of the two models comes equipped with Ford's G.O.A.T. drive modes, allowing you to go over all types of terrain. The entry model of each of the two lineups comes standard with five modes, but the upper trims bring more capability with up to seven terrain modes in select grades. However, the Bronco has an advantage, thanks to standard HOSS performance-oriented suspensions and a minimum ground clearance of 8.3 inches. Smooth to handle on paved and unpaved roads alike, the Bronco Sport has a ground clearance of 7.8 inches and comes standard with a range of driver assistance technologies, such as adaptive cruise control with stop-and-go, evasive steering assistance, and intersection assistance. These features make it easier to drive in rush-hour traffic. Design The two Bronco models are also different in terms of design. The big Bronco can be had in two-door and four-door configurations, with capacity for four or five riders. With a shorter wheelbase, the two-door variant is a great choice if you need enhanced maneuverability on narrow trails. The four-door variant offers enhanced space and comfort. Both variants have removable doors and a removable top, so you can enjoy open-air adventures. All Bronco Sport trim levels are offered in a four-door, five-seat configuration with fixed doors and roof. Ultimate Performance Unleashed: The 2025 Ford Mustang GTD

Ever wondered what would happen if Ford took the spirit of the Mustang and added a little fighter jet DNA? The 2025 Ford Mustang GTD is what. With a sub-7-minute time on the grueling Nürburgring circuit securing its international reputation as an elite supercar, the Mustang GTD is the fastest and most powerful street-legal pony car made yet. Fighter Jet DNA Even the highest-performing vehicles on the planet must contend with physics. The same four forces that govern the behavior of the world's fighter jets like the legendary Lockheed Martin F-22 Raptor also impacted the Mustang GTD. And Ford drew more than inspiration from the F-22; Ford makes the Mustang GTD's serial plate and available 3D-printed paddle shifters out of titanium recycled from decommissioned Raptors. Thrust The core of the Mustang GTD's unbelievable performance is a supercharged 5.2-liter V8 based on the legendary Predator engine. With a redline of 7,650 RPM and the ability to pump out an unbelievable 815 horsepower, the Mustang GTD can attain a top speed of a jaw-dropping 202 miles per hour. The engine is slung low for an improved center of gravity and mated to an 8-speed transaxle for incredible performance. The engine is fed its oil by the first dry-sump oil system featured on a street-legal Mustang, which keeps the engine well supplied with lubrication even when operating under high-G cornering conditions. more Lift The engine's massive output offers massive lift, which is countered by the massive carbon fiber spoiler securely mounted to the C-pillar. The resulting downforce keeps the wheels in full contact with the road for better handling. Available active aerodynamics also help tune lift and drag depending on prevailing conditions. Drag At the kinds of speed the Mustang GTD can generate, far more energy is used to overcome air resistance than to overcome friction from the ground. Ford designed the Mustang GTD's body for maximum airflow. Available vented front fenders help reduce drag by letting air flow through the wheel well rather than build up pressure, and the available underbody aerodynamic plate helps improve airflow underneath the body. Weight The Mustang GTD features a stunning power-to-weight ratio and nearly 50/50 balance. Lightweight yet strong carbon fiber is used for more than just body panels; even the driveshaft is made of carbon fiber to save weight. The exhaust system is also made of titanium for weight savings, and the available forged magnesium wheels reduce weight even further. Electrify Your Drive with the 2025 Ford F-150 Lightning

The Ford F-150 is the truck of legend, America's best-selling pickup truck for over forty years. Its cousin, the 2025 Ford F-150 Lightning, has all of its abilities and is all electric. We're going to look closer at some of the features that make the Lightning the top of the tree of electric full-sized pickup trucks in the US. Electrifying Features of the 2025 Ford F-150 Lightning Powering Your House Yep, you read that correctly. Power outages can happen, and if power is lost due to a natural disaster, your home could be without electricity for several days. If this happens, the Lightning comes to your rescue with this handy feature. There are a few minor and inexpensive modifications you'll need to make to your home, and your Lightning will be ready to serve as a backup generator. You'll need the 80-amp Ford Charge Station Pro, which you've probably already installed when you bought your Lightning, to allow it to recharge at home. You'll also need the Home Integration System from Sunrun, Ford's trusted provider. With both systems in place, you'll be ready if the lights go out. Simply plug the cable into your F-150 Lightning, and you'll beat the darkness. more Great Fuel Economy Fuel economy is important even when a vehicle doesn't use gasoline or diesel. MPGe measures how far an electric vehicle can travel on a gallon equivalent of electricity. The standard Lightning battery is rated at 76 MPGe in the city and 61 MPGe on the highway, providing a driving range on a full charge of up to 240 miles. The available extended-range battery is even more efficient, supplying 78 MPGe in the city and 63 MPGe on the highway, giving you an effective range of 300 to 320 miles if your battery is fully juiced. Both battery types are covered by warranty for the first eight years or 100,000 miles, whichever comes first. Advanced Technology The Lighting includes a range of advanced technology to make your driving experience easier than ever. SYNCH technology is available and seamlessly links your smartphone to your vehicle, enabling you to access everything you need through your 15.5" infotainment screen. SYNCH is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atible and easy to connect via Bluetooth. Ford Co-Pilot360 is a range of advanced driver assistance features pre-installed in the Lightning. These features use cameras, sonar, and radar to protect you from accidents by identifying potential collision situations and warning you so you can take action. BlueCruise is another advanced technology that enables you to drive hand-free on an ever-increasing network of roads through the US and Canada. America's Favorite Truck: The 2025 Ford F-150

Now ready for test drives, the 2025 Ford F-150 offers engines that are ready to work and play tough, first-class interior comforts, and innovative technology. Six Engines to Meet Different Needs Combining available four-wheel drive and other off-roading extras with six engine options, this edition of the F-150 is more than ready to tackle challenges on and off-road. XL, STX, and XLT trims all come with a 325-horsepower V6, while Platinum and King Ranch trims take power to the next level with a 3.5-liter V6 that generates 400 horsepower while towing up to 13,500 pounds, the strongest towing capabilities in the lineup. When hauling cargo in the cabin or bed, the 400-horsepower V8 that comes with Tremor and Lariat trims is ideal, as it offers the best payload capacity of 3,310 pounds. There's also an available 3.5-liter full hybrid V6 that combines excellent fuel efficiency with a 430-horsepower output. The Raptor trim's two engine options include a standard 450-horsepower high-output 3.5-liter and an available supercharged 5.2-liter V8 that churns out a jaw-dropping 720 horses. more Convenience, Comfort, and Design Inside the cabin, cargo is easily accommodated with the standard 60/40 split-folding rear seat, and, in select models, a fully flat load floor. While lower trims have a bench seat up front, many trims come with multi-contour bucket seats that offer available thermal settings and Active Motion massage, as well as optional heated rear seats. This truck's design has multiple tailgate choices available, depending on the trim level, including a power-releasable tailgate and the Pro Access Tailgate, the latter of which has swing-away doors. The bed offers standard cargo tie-down hooks, a cargo lamp, and options like spray-in bedliner and three types of tonneau covers. Technology to Enhance Every Drive The cabin's standard SYNC 4 infotainment system has a 12-inch color touchscreen display, but you can also use its Enhanced Voice Recognition technology for controlling phone calls and other functions. This system pairs perfectly with any of the multiple audio systems that are available, a 12-inch full-color instrument cluster sits behind the steering wheel, and the Pro Power Onboard electricity generator is just one of many productivity features available. Advanced safety and driver-assist features found in every model include AdvanceTrac with Roll Stability Control (RSC), Curve Control, and collision-avoidance systems like the Rear View Camera, Pre-Collision Assist with Automatic Emergency Braking, Lane-Keeping System, BLIS (Blind Spot Information System), and Auto High-Beam Headlamps. Available features include Adaptive Cruise Control with Stop and Go, BlueCruise for hands-free driving, and Intersection Assist 2.0. A New Era Begins with the 2025 Ford Mustang Mach-E

Eye-catching, agile, and comfortable, the 2025 Ford Mustang Mach-E is one of the best electric SUVs you can drive today. Various battery packs, drivetrains, and customization options make it easy to build the transporter of your dreams. 2025 Ford Mustang Mach-E Basics The 2025 Mustang Mach-E carries on its predecessor's legacy, living up to any task you might throw its way. Four trims bring various levels of performance, making it easy to pick the right ride. The entry Select and Premium models are offered with a standard-range battery paired with rear-wheel drive, delivering a driving range of 260 miles per charge. All-wheel drive is available, and you can also opt for the extended-range battery to get up to 320 miles of range, depending on the drivetrain. Made for performance, the GT and Rally models come standard with the extended-range battery pack and all-wheel drive. more Styling and Interior With an exterior inspired by the original Mustang, the Mach-E is an SUV designed to stand out. Its sporty lines mix with aerodynamic curves and a supple profile that enhances the vehicle's aerodynamic performance. The wide stance creates a commanding road presence while also enhancing balance and handling, especially in challenging driving situations. Classic and attention-grabbing colors, such as Desert Sand and Grabber Yellow, allow you to express your personality. Inside, the new Mach-E boasts a futuristic design with a streamlined dash and center console, a huge center touchscreen, and a stylish digital gauge behind the steering wheel. Power and Handling Good looks meet impressive performance in the new Mach-E regardless of the model and battery option. In the base configuration, the Select trim outputs 264 horsepower and 387 lb.-ft of torque, which is plenty of power for city driving, tailgating, and casual off-roading. With the extended-range battery, the same trim delivers 370 horsepower and 500 lb.-ft of torque. For fun at the racetracks or high-speed off-roading, you can opt for the GT or Rally trims. Both models offer 480 horsepower and up to 700 lb.-ft of torque, sprinting to 60 mph from a standstill in under four seconds. Modern Technologies Each 2025 Mach-E model comes packed with modern technologies, including the SYNC 4A infotainment system that includes SiriusXM with 360L, modem capability, and connected navigation. For easy vehicle access, you can use your phone as a key, and each trim comes equipped with a universal garage door opener for added convenience. Driver assistance technologies include the Ford Co-Pilot360 Active 2.0 suite, a surround-view camera, and Ford BlueCruise, a feature that enables hands-free driving.
